Hey, Matt! What about Captain Power? Remember that one – where you bought the toys and the show’s bad guys shot back at you? If you got hit, your action figure out be blown out of the cockpit of the ship you were holding like a gun.

Oh, and the toys worked one-on-one, too, like pre-Lazer Tag.

The show was done by the guy who did B5. And really, the whole concept was before its time!
